I use a Python application that requires wxPython 2.8. Some features of the application do not work with wxPython 2.6. I installed py-wxPython28-common and py-wxPython28-unicode from the instructions in PR 11349, PR 11350, and PR 11351. Now all of the features of my application work as they should. I am not a Python developer nor am I qualified to critique a port, but I do find value in the work that was submitted in those PRs and would like to see it committed to the ports tree.
